240 发简信
IP属地:上海
  • docker运行jupyter逐步操作笔记

    运行环境:在VMware中运行一台OS为centos8的宿主机,在上面运行docker 目标:把fastai的镜像起起来,并且能够看到jupyter界面 分解: 看看人家的d...

  • 120
    Synchronized锁升级知识(完成偏向锁部分)

    Synchronized锁升级分为四个步骤,无锁,偏向锁,轻量锁,重量锁 这四个状态在对象头,用mark word中的两个bit来区分 从无锁到偏向锁,起到锁作用的变量是:对...

  • 写的很详细,感谢

    Flink--Checkpoint机制原理

    基于flink-1.8.1 本文转载自一文搞懂Flink内部的Exactly Once和At Least Once 如何理解flink中state(状态) state泛指 s...

  • 120
    Flink--Checkpoint机制原理

    基于flink-1.8.1 本文转载自一文搞懂Flink内部的Exactly Once和At Least Once 如何理解flink中state(状态) state泛指 s...

  • 120
    为什么大家都不戳破深度学习的本质?!

    自从去年 AlphaGo 完虐李世乭,深度学习火了。但似乎没人说得清它的原理,只是把它当作一个黑箱来使。有人说,深度学习就是一个非线性分类器[1]?有人说,深度学习是对人脑的...

  • 感谢分享

    读书的目的

    分享下我近两年读完的书单,发觉我读书一直以来,都是在寻找这三个问题的答案: 1、这个世界未来会是怎样/我所期望的未来是什么?S:《未来简史》《生命3.0》《机器人时代》A:《...

  • 读书的目的

    分享下我近两年读完的书单,发觉我读书一直以来,都是在寻找这三个问题的答案: 1、这个世界未来会是怎样/我所期望的未来是什么?S:《未来简史》《生命3.0》《机器人时代》A:《...

  • 120
    三维抓手模型

    加入滴滴已三月有余了,这期间我所接触到的、经历过的、尝试着手去解决的种种业务问题,不论是其本身的复杂程度而言,还是在问题解决过程中我所收获的成长,均远超过去。 而在我所有收获...

  • 120
    Java可重入锁详解

    作者: 一字马胡 转载标志 【2017-11-03】 更新日志 前言 在java中,锁是实现并发的关键组件,多个线程之间的同步关系需要锁来保证,所谓锁,其语义就是资源获取到...

  • Java生产者和消费者模型的5种实现方式

    前言 生产者和消费者问题是线程模型中的经典问题:生产者和消费者在同一时间段内共用同一个存储空间,生产者往存储空间中添加产品,消费者从存储空间中取走产品,当存储空间为空时,消费...

  • interface 和 superclass 并不一样,文中称 Animal 为超类并不恰当。我最初接触 go 的时候确实感觉到它的简洁,但是很快也发现了很多过于简洁的部分。比如没有了 implements 关键字,无疑加重了代码维护时程序员的心智负担,在你看到 Dog 的定义时,你完全不可能知道它实现了 Animal 接口,我想没有人会背上所有类库中所有接口对应的方法签名,反之你只有通过阅读文档,才会有可能知道原来 Dog 实现了 Animal 接口,而写文档的人是有可能由于疏忽忘记了对一两个接口的注明,但是如果提供了 implements 关键字配合编译器期间的 type checking,那么就可以在编译期间发现接口实现的问题,并且由于有了 implements 关键字,在看到 Dog 类型的定义时,会很显示的知道,原来它实现了 Animal 接口